1How quickly can I expect a water damage restoration company to respond to an emergency in Macy, especially during our stormy seasons?

In Macy and surrounding Miami County, reputable local restoration companies typically offer 24/7 emergency response and aim to be on-site within 60-90 minutes. This is critical during Indiana's spring thunderstorms and summer downpours, where rapid response can prevent secondary damage like mold, which can begin to develop within 24-48 hours in our humid Midwest climate. Always confirm the service area and guaranteed response time when you call.

2Are there specific local permits or regulations in Macy, IN, I need to be aware of for major fire or structural restoration?

Yes, for significant structural repairs, you will likely need permits from the Miami County Building Department. Macy itself may have specific zoning ordinances, and any work on older homes may need to consider local historic guidelines. A trustworthy Macy-area restoration contractor will handle this permitting process for you, ensuring all work meets Indiana's building codes and local regulations, which is a key reason to hire a licensed local professional.

3What is the most common cause of property damage requiring restoration services in the Macy area?

The most frequent causes are water damage from severe weather and appliance failures, followed by fire and smoke damage. Macy's location in Northern Indiana means homes are susceptible to heavy rain, basement flooding from saturated ground, and winter freeze-thaw cycles that can burst pipes. Summer storms with high winds can also cause roof damage leading to water intrusion, making weather-related incidents a predominant concern.

4How do I choose a reliable restoration service provider in the Macy, Indiana area?

Look for providers licensed in Indiana, insured, and certified by the IICRC (Institute of Inspection Cleaning and Restoration Certification). Check for strong local references and community presence, as they understand regional building styles and common issues. It's also wise to choose a company that works directly with your insurance company to streamline claims, a common need after major storm events in our region.

5Does homeowner's insurance in Indiana typically cover mold remediation, and when is it usually covered?

Standard Indiana homeowner's policies often exclude mold damage unless it is a direct result of a "covered peril," like water damage from a sudden burst pipe or storm-related roof leak. It will not cover mold from long-term neglect or humidity. Given Macy's humidity, prompt water extraction after an incident is vital. Always document the initial water damage thoroughly and contact your restoration pro immediately, as they can provide documentation to support your insurance claim.
